Job Summary This position is responsible for the management and marketing of Expand's Appalachian liquids marketing portfolio (Purity NGLs + Condensate). Priorities include value creation, flow assurance, identifying & evaluating potential new opportunities, communicating with leadership, and efficiently managing a team of individuals working towards the same goals.
Job Duties & Responsibilities
Directly manages a team of marketing professionals to facilitate the sale, maximum flow assurance, and peer leading netback pricing on a book of ~125,000 bpd of condensate and purity NGLs
Proactively seeks out opportunities to generate additional value from optimizing assets and the company's transportation portfolio with equity production or third party purchases
Coordinates between various disciplines/business units and Marketing. Must possess the ability to bridge technical and market based learning gaps conveying critical marketing concepts to groups with different backgrounds
Performs comprehensive assessments of regionalized crude & purity NGL Markets including the availability of transportation capacity, relative netback values and liquidity of markets
Prepares and presents executive level presentation material achieving transparency on all market conditions
Develops marketing plans/strategies, contacts 3rd party transporters/midstream service providers to confirm market assessments and facilitate ongoing business
Evaluates business system requirements and makes recommendations to Sr. Management on necessary tools as well assisting in system implementations
Builds, develops, and maintains commercial relationships with midstream transporters, buyers, sellers, and midstream solution providers
Manages internal processes in an organized fashion, such as but not limited to contracting, credit, indemnity/safety training, counterparty setup, and transaction system integration
Job Specific Skills
Comprehensive understanding of the North American oil and purity NGL products marketplace with working knowledge of all aspects of Southwest Appalachia oil and Ngl markets and infrastructure. Ideal candidate also has a basic understanding of North American Natural Gas market
Ability to understand and explain basic processing/fractionation calculations to enable accurate review of processing statements, and to monitor NGL "available for sale" process & imbalances
